INGREDIENTS
Watermelon 5 cups (750 g) - pulp
Sugar ½ cup (105 g)
Lemon juice 1
Preparation

How to prepare Watermelon Sorbet

To prepare the watermelon sorbet, take the watermelon 1, remove the rind 1 and obtain 600 g (about 1.3 lbs) of pulp. With a spoon, scoop out the inner pulp with the seeds 2, then cut the rest into cubes 3.

Pass only the pulp with the seeds through a sieve 4 to obtain only the liquid part 5. Now in a jug, pour the pulp cubes, the sugar 5, and the previously filtered watermelon juice 5.

Add the lemon juice 7 and blend everything with an immersion blender 8 until the sugar is dissolved 9.

Pour the mixture into the ice cream maker 10 and let it churn until you get a creamy sorbet 11, which will take about 20-30 minutes, depending on the type of ice cream maker. Serve the watermelon sorbet well chilled and enjoy immediately 12.

Storage

Store your sorbet in the freezer for 3-4 days, placed in an airtight container.

Tip

If you don't have an ice cream maker, place the mixture in a bowl and put it in the freezer, remembering to break it up with a fork every half hour until you achieve the right creaminess and density for your sorbet. It will take about 3 hours.
